The Way The Motor Starts
Motor starting methods include: full-voltage direct start, self-coupling decompression start, Y-δ start, soft starter, frequency converter.
Full pressure direct start:
In cases where both grid capacity and load allow full-voltage direct starting, full-voltage direct starting can be considered. The advantages are convenient operation and control, simple maintenance, and relatively economical. It is mainly used for the starting of low-power motors, and from the perspective of saving electric energy, motors larger than 11kW should not use this method.
Autocoupling decompression start:
The use of autotransformer multi-tap decompression, which can not only adapt to the needs of different load starting, but also obtain larger starting torque, is a decompression starting method that is often used to start larger capacity motors. Its biggest advantage is that the starting torque is large, when its winding tap is at 80%, the starting torque can reach 64% of the direct start. And the starting torque can be adjusted by the tap. It is still widely used today.
Y-δ start:
For the squirrel cage asynchronous motor with the stator winding of the normal operation is triangular connection, if the stator winding is connected into a star shape when starting, and then connected into a triangle after starting, the starting current can be reduced and its impact on the power grid can be reduced. Such a starting method is called star-delta decompression start, or simply star-delta starting (y-δ start). When starting with the star-delta method, the starting current is only 1/3 of the original direct start according to the delta connection method. If the starting current at direct start is calculated as 6~7ie, the starting current is only 2~2.3 times when starting the star-delta. This means that when starting with the star triangle, the starting torque is also reduced to 1/3 of the original direct start according to the triangle connection method. It is suitable for no-load or light-load starting. And compared with any other decompression starter, its structure is the simplest and the cheapest price. In addition, the star-delta starting method has another advantage, that is, when the load is light, the motor can be allowed to run under the star connection. At this time, the rated torque can be matched to the load, which can improve the efficiency of the motor and thus save power consumption.
